What is recorded here

Circular enclosure identified as a crop mark on Bing (viewed 03/01/2015). The enclosure (c.30m diam.) appears to predate a field boundary that formed the western limit of Kit’s Green and the townland boundary between Common and Corrstown. The field boundary has since been removed. It is possible that this site is the ‘supposed site of old Fort or Burying Ground’ marked on the 1st edition OS map.
